Output 143867765d94f3033c072dc82f1b62b939aaa27772a802839e90641b03fd85ba:2

value
72521817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82a2b901d89ef013f40fbae8a5891fcc47254a7a OP_EQUAL
address
3DbkhemgzpU5hhtSW6QmRcZuf6CAQNSzgX
transaction
143867765d94f3033c072dc82f1b62b939aaa27772a802839e90641b03fd85ba
spent
true